Lifestyle Changes

Treatment strategies include regular exercise and a healthy diet, as well as getting rid of triggers for ADHD symptoms. A good night's sleep and adhering to a routine can also help. These lifestyle changes may be challenging initially, but they can help to minimize the effects and enhance the quality of life.

People with ADD may find it difficult to complete tasks and remain organized, which is why creating a daily schedule and keeping on top of deadlines is an essential part of a successful treatment. Making use of a planner, creating lists of tasks, and setting reminders can also improve productivity. Breaking large projects into smaller steps and taking breaks from the screen can also help.

People with ADHD might be enticed by the temptation to take on too many social or work commitments. However, a full schedule can stress people and lead to a loss of concentration. Individuals with ADHD should make a habit of checking their calendar before agreeing to new commitments. For those who struggle to remember details, it may be beneficial to use visual aids or a system of color-coding that can help improve efficiency in organizing.

Eating a balanced diet can significantly improve symptoms of ADHD. It is recommended that you restrict sugar as well as simple carbohydrates and unhealthy fats and eat plenty of vegetables, fruits, and lean proteins.

It is essential to maintain a healthy weight for people with ADD. A low-fat diet will also aid in avoiding blood sugar spikes, which can lead to hyperactivity and poor concentration.

Counseling

If your inattentional ADHD symptoms are interfering with your personal or professional life, you might want to talk to a counselor. Counseling can be a crucial aspect of adult ADHD treatment, as it helps you deal with the condition and create an optimistic outlook on your life. Counseling also can address any other mental health issues that you might have, such as addiction or depression, and help you manage them alongside your ADHD.

Inattentive ADHD symptoms of adhd in adults and treatment typically manifest in the early years of childhood, but they can be a major barrier to success for adults in the workplace, in school and in relationships. Inability to focus on tasks or track expenses and schedule appointments is a common problem. People with inattention ADHD struggle to stay on task during conversations and lectures and are easily distracted by other thoughts or activities.

There are many types of counseling. However the majority of treatments for inattentive ADHD combine medication with behavioral therapy. These medications work faster, but are temporary, while behavioral therapy provides long-term advantages.

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) teaches new skills that assist you in controlling your ADHD symptoms and improve your daily functioning. You can learn to prioritize tasks, make lists and develop a framework for managing your time. CBT will teach you how to identify your ideal concentration rate and plan your daily activities around it.

Individual talk therapy can help you overcome emotional baggage from a life of failure and disappointment. You can tackle the root causes of your negative self-image and the resentment you feel when others criticize your lack of attention and impulsiveness. Family and marriage therapy is effective in resolving patterns of conflict.
